Even with a solid understanding of Tunic's puzzle mechanics, some challenges stand out as particularly devious. This section provides direct solutions and detailed explanations for a few of the game's most notorious head-scratchers. Remember, while these solutions will get you past the immediate hurdle, the true joy of Tunic often lies in the "aha!" moment of discovery. Consider these a last resort if you're truly stuck, or a way to confirm your own deductions.

  • The Golden Path (Overworld Glyph Puzzle): This monumental puzzle, often referred to as the "Golden Path," is arguably the game's ultimate test of observation and pattern recognition. The solution is literally drawn out for you on Page 1 of the instruction manual. It's a continuous line that traces a specific path across the entire overworld map, connecting various points. You must input this exact sequence using the D-pad (or equivalent controls) while standing on the central golden platform in the Overworld. The key is to follow the exact turns and segments depicted, even if it seems counter-intuitive at times. Pay close attention to the starting point and the direction of the first segment.
  • The Sealed Temple Door (Glyph Sequence): Located in the Sealed Temple, this door requires a specific sequence of glyphs to open. The solution is found on Page 49 of the instruction manual, disguised as a series of environmental markings. Each marking corresponds to a D-pad input. The sequence is: Up, Left, Down, Left, Down, Right, Down, Right, Up, Right, Up, Left, Up, Left, Down, Left, Down, Right, Down, Right, Up, Right, Up, Left, Up. Input this carefully while facing the door.
  • The Mountain Door (Sound Puzzle): This puzzle, found within the Mountain, relies on auditory cues and the instruction manual. The solution is on Page 29. You need to listen to the distinct sounds played by the nearby statues and then input the corresponding D-pad directions based on the manual's visual representation of those sounds. The sequence is typically: Up, Right, Down, Left, Up, Right, Down, Left, Up, Right, Down, Left.

For any other specific puzzle you're struggling with, always refer back to your instruction manual. The answer is almost always hidden in plain sight within its pages, often requiring a different perspective or a deeper understanding of the game's unique language.
